With the mornings becoming colder, more and more students enjoy staying inside before the bell rings. Room 17 has quite a number of chess players and they enjoy a few games before core learning begins. Chess Club is also proving to be popular with the wider Year 5/6 Kererū team.

Listening to them talk strategy, maintain focus and attempting to out maneuver one another is really cool to watch. A number of beginner or non chess players have begun observing the strategy, rules and gaining an understanding of the terms involved.

Other students prefer to play card games or make card towers. All of these activities have the same positive outcome of connecting with peers, working together and a calm start to the day.
